Understanding AR Glasses

AR glasses are wearable devices that overlay digital information onto the real world, offering users an enhanced view of their surroundings. Key features include real-time data visualization, gesture interaction, and connectivity with other smart devices. Major players like Apple, Google, and Microsoft have already made significant strides in this space, leveraging AR glasses in industries such as healthcare, retail, and education to revolutionize user experiences.

The Rise of Open Source in Tech

The open source movement has a rich history, starting from the collaborative efforts in software development to the transformative impact on modern tech ecosystems. Collaboration, transparency, and cost-effectiveness are the cornerstones of open source, enabling diverse talents to contribute to projects without the constraints of proprietary systems. Notable successes like the Linux operating system and the Apache web server exemplify open source's potential to drive innovation.

Benefits of Open Source in AR Glass Development

Open source offers numerous advantages in AR glass development, such as:

  • Cost Reduction: Lower development costs make AR technology more accessible to smaller companies and independent developers.
  • Accelerated Innovation: Community-driven collaboration leads to faster problem-solving and feature development.
  • Flexibility: Open source solutions can be customized to meet specific user needs, enhancing the versatility of AR applications.

Challenges and Considerations

Despite its benefits, open source in AR development is not without challenges. Intellectual property concerns and security issues are notable risks, as the open nature of these projects can sometimes lead to vulnerabilities. Balancing open source contributions with proprietary advancements is essential to ensure both innovation and security.
